Transaction 6146728108617c71530281a04300d85ca002ef7fd65a833cbe4240b518266f55
1 Input
1 Output
-
6146728108617c71530281a04300d85ca002ef7fd65a833cbe4240b518266f55:0
- value
- 54501
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b796cfee759f1314f36ecb6a0c0e17500b22b5cc OP_EQUAL
- address
- 3JRkFGQBF9LsNUyrJnq1xn7DJB2zFArjKu